Chapter 125: The Effects of Dragon Blood (Teaser)

Sieg had many matters to attend to. When they parted ways, he handed Wang Yu another mana crystal card worth over a thousand gold coins—this was several months' worth of Wang Yu's salary, along with a bonus for his contribution during the demon invasion.

It was a hefty sum. Holding the mana crystal card, Wang Yu felt like a half-rich man again. But as always, money came quickly and disappeared just as fast.

By the time he returned home, it was still early and Avia wasn't yet back. The battle in the capital's shadow had cost Wang Yu little to nothing—his body was simply built that way. As long as he wasn't dead, he could rapidly recover from injuries and fatigue given sufficient nutrients.

Wang Yu placed the vial of dragon blood that Sieg had given him on the table and observed the liquid within. It was purer and much more transparent than human blood—it was hard to believe that this was actually blood in the first place.

According to what he had read, bathing in dragon blood could greatly enhance one's physical constitution. The exact mechanism was unknown given the rarity of dragon blood, and no one had been able to study the phenomenon in depth.
